Product Description
The San Jamar C4400PF is a wall or cooler-mounted pull-type dispenser designed to hold foam beverage cups in the 12 to 24oz range. It operates on a gravity-fed, top-loading principle — cups are loaded from the top and dispensed one at a time by pulling from the base. The stainless steel tube construction gives it a clean, professional appearance that suits front-of-house and back-of-house environments alike.

The self-adjusting mechanism accommodates the full 12 to 24oz foam cup range without requiring separate sizing rings, which simplifies restocking when cup sizes change between service periods or across different beverages.

Installation is straightforward — the unit attaches to most standard wall surfaces or cooler exteriors using the included mounting hardware. There are no electrical or plumbing requirements. It is worth confirming the rim diameter of your specific foam cups falls within the 82 to 98mm range before ordering, as foam cup dimensions can vary between manufacturers even within the same nominal fluid ounce size.
This dispenser is well suited to cafés, canteens, self-service counters, convenience-style beverage stations, and anywhere foam cups are dispensed at moderate to high volume. For very high-throughput sites dispensing multiple cup sizes simultaneously, a multi-sleeve or under-counter dispensing solution may be worth considering.
